About Redbank 4301

The size of Redbank is approximately 8.3 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 3.1% of total area. The population of Redbank in 2011 was 1,605 people. By 2016 the population was 1,848 showing a population growth of 15.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Redbank is 10-19 years. Households in Redbank are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Redbank work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 52% of the homes in Redbank were owner-occupied compared with 49.6% in 2016.
